Raymond Baten (born 26 January 1989) is an Aruban international footballer who plays for Dutch club ASV De Dijk, as a midfielder.
Career
Baten has played for Voorschoten '97, FC Rijnvogels, RKVV Westlandia, Quick (H) and ASV De Dijk.[2]
He made his international debut for Aruba in 2011.[2]
